Welcome to the USDA Income and Property Eligibility Site. This site is used to evaluate the likelihood that a potential applicant would be eligible for program assistance. In order to be eligible for many USDA loans, household income must meet certain guidelines.
USDA Income Limits USDA loans are for low-to-medium income individuals and families. Your household income cannot exceed 115% of your area median income. Most moderate income families will meet the income requirements for a rural development loan.
